# rimgo
An alternative frontend for Imgur. Originally based on [rimgu](https://codeberg.org/3np/rimgu).

## Features
- Lightweight
- No JavaScript
- No ads or tracking
- No sign up or app install prompts
- Bandwidth efficient - automatically uses newer image formats (if enabled)

## Comparison
Comparing rimgo to Imgur.

### Speed
Tested using [Google PageSpeed Insights](https://pagespeed.web.dev/).

| | [rimgo](https://pagespeed.web.dev/report?url=https%3A%2F%2Fi.bcow.xyz%2Fgallery%2FgYiQLWy) | [Imgur](https://pagespeed.web.dev/report?url=https%3A%2F%2Fimgur.com%2Fgallery%2FgYiQLWy) |
| ------------------- | ------- | --------- |
| Performance | 91 | 28 |
| Request count | 29 | 340 |
| Resource Size | 218 KiB | 2,542 KiB |
| Time to Interactive | 1.6s | 23.8s |

### Privacy
Imgur collects information about your device and uses tracking cookies for advertising, this is mentioned in their [privacy policy](https://imgur.com/privacy/). [Blacklight](https://themarkup.org/blacklight) found 31 trackers and 87 third-party cookies.

## Usage
Replace imgur.com or i.imgur.com with the instance domain. For i.stack.imgur.com, replace i.stack.imgur.com with the instance domain and add stack/ before the media ID. You can use a browser extension to do this [automatically](#automatically-redirect-links).

Imgur: `https://imgur.com/gallery/j2sOQkJ` -> `https://rimgo.bcow.xyz/gallery/j2sOQkJ`
Stack Overflow: `https://i.stack.imgur.com/KnO3v.jpg?s=64&g=1` -> `https://rimgo.bcow.xyz/stack/KnO3v.jpg?s=64&g=1`

## License
This software is released under the AGPL-3.0 license. If you make any modifications to the code and distribute it (including use on a network server), you must publicly distribute your changes and release them under the AGPL-3.0.

## Legal notice
rimgo does not allow uploads or host any content, media. All content on any rimgo instances is from Imgur™. Imgur is a trademark of Imgur, Inc. Any issues with content on rimgo should be be reported to Imgur. rimgo is not affiliated with Imgur, Inc.
